The story follows Mimi, the pampered, only daughter of a wealthy Kolkata businessman, whose life takes a dramatic and terrifying turn on the day of her departure for higher studies abroad.Mimi’s marriage has been smoothly arranged with Aryan, her childhood best friend and the son of her father’s close friend. Following a warm engagement ceremony and a sweet farewell lunch with Aryan, Mimi heads to the airport driven by their loyal driver, Ramu Kaka. However, fate takes a dark turn when their car breaks down midway. Stranded on the road after sending the driver away, Mimi is suddenly surrounded and chased by a group of rowdy thugs who claim to "know" her and want revenge.While running for her life, Mimi collides with a car belonging to Mahir Sen, a wealthy man whose sheer intimidating presence sends the thugs running in terror. Desperate, Mimi hitches a ride with him to reach the airport, but instead of the airport, a furious Mahir kidnaps her and forcefully brings her to his beautiful suburban villa.At the villa, a bewildered Mimi is thrust into a massive identity crisis. A sweet 5-year-old girl named Nidhi runs to her, calling her "Mammum" (Mother), and the housemaid addresses her as "Boudimoni" (Madam). It becomes shockingly clear that Mimi looks exactly like Mahir's runaway wife—a woman who allegedly betrayed Mahir, abandoned her innocent child, and eloped with another man.Despite Mimi's desperate pleas that she is a victim of mistaken identity, a deeply hurt and vengeful Mahir refuses to believe her. He believes she is just acting. He traps her in the house, subjecting her to his intense rage and bitter confrontations, demanding to know the name of her lover. Amidst this terrifying ordeal, Mimi feels an unexplainable, deep emotional pull toward the innocent little Nidhi, who refuses to eat from anyone else's hand.The story reaches a tense cliffhanger as Mahir aggressively corners Mimi against the wall, demanding answers for destroying his family, only to be interrupted by a soft knock on the door by little Nidhi, leaving Mimi trapped in a dangerous web of a past she knows nothing about.
